Synopsis As Introduced
Amends the Humane Care for Animals Act. Provides that, upon request of the Department of Agriculture (now, that request is not required), an approved humane investigator may, for the purpose of investigating an alleged violation of the Act, enter during normal business hours upon any premises where the animal or animals described in the complaint are housed or kept, provided such entry shall not be made into any building which is a person's residence, except by search warrant or court order. Effective immediately.

Senate Committee Amendment No. 1
Deletes everything after the enacting clause. Makes a technical change to a Section concerning investigation of complaints.
